Like I said before ..moving venues wouldnt matter a jot as long as the fans turned up and supported the event....a new venue with relatively full houses and mainstream TV would mean Lakeside would soon be forgotten........but a new venue with hardly anybody there in front of the TV cameras would be disastrous and would put the long term event in jeopardy..

If they moved to newer better venue...got TV..got the sponsorship and got the crowds turning up then it could genuinely be the new era they want....my concern is that would the fans who go to Lakeside continue to go elsewhere..and then there is the problem of attracting a new generation of fans to turn up .

It better be, the Masters qualification cutoff is normally at the end of August. (I note they haven't actually put a cutoff date in the diary yet...) The willingness of international players to travel to the tournament could hit an all-time low if the relevant issues aren't resolved soon.

Of course, if the Masters somehow fails to go ahead altogether that's all moot, but in that case the BDO will have a far bigger issue on its hands than having pissed off international players.
